We provide IT Staff Augmentation Services!

Automation Architect Resume

2.00/5 (Submit Your Rating)

St Louis, MO

SUMMARY

  • 11+ Years of IT professional experience in, QA Automation Architect, QA Manager, with various domain exposures like Telecom (OSS and BSS), Banking, Healthcare, Retail, ERP
  • Proficient in Automation Frame works in Selenium, Cucumber (BDD) like Data Driven, Hybrid and Keyword Driven, unite and Regression Testing. Experience in CORE Java using OOPS Concept, Extensively used java, Java Scripts
  • Automated functional test cases using Selenium Web Driver, Cucumber (JUNIT and Java TESTNG)
  • Extensively worked in executing tests by using Selenium grid/Testing in different browsers/Cross Browser testing.
  • Strong knowledge and extensive experience in various types of testing (Unit, Integration, API, Smoke, System, Browser compatibility, etc.) is required
  • Working knowledge in Web development and testing tools like Firebug, Fire Path, XPath, DOM Inspector, and Chrome Console.
  • Identify issues and risks and work with project team to develop mitigation plans and provide timely escalation.
  • Well exposed to different troubleshooting/debugging/testing/version control methodologies.
  • Good Analytical skill, Strong problem solving and troubleshooting skills with the ability to exercise mature judgment.
  • Good Experience in creating XPath queries and functions.
  • Ability to enhance the existing Automation framework and develop functions, methods in Page Object Model
  • Experience in GitHub,TestNG Jenkins, JIRA, Restful Web services, Postman, JUnit, Maven, Eclipse
  • Having excellent hands on Expertise in Analysis, Design, and Development & Implementation of application systems.
  • Good work experience in Waterfall, Agile and SaFe delivery models
  • Experience in conducting Sprint planning, Standup meeting, retrospective etc..
  • Assessing the Scrum Maturity of the team(s) and organization and coaching the team to higher levels of maturity, Confidential a pace that is sustainable and comfortable for the team and organization.
  • Exposure in maintaining Product Backlog tracking, Burn down metrics, Velocity, EPIC, User Stories and related project documentation.
  • Proactively communicate project status and drives resolution of outstanding risks, issues, and action items

TECHNICAL SKILLS

Programming Languages: Core JAVA, C, C++

Web/XML Technologies: HTML, DHTML, CSS, JavaScript,, XPATH, XSD, XML

Frameworks: Selenium Automation, Cucumber (BDD), DevOps, GitHub

Tools: & Utilities: Eclipse IDE, Maven, HP - ALM, Confidential &T - TDP, D2-Jira, Rally

RDBMS: Oracle, SQL, MS Access

Source Control: Rational Clear Case, Microsoft VSS, Share Point

Operating Systems: Windows 10

PROFESSIONAL EXPERIENCE

Confidential, St Louis, MO

Automation Architect

Responsibilities:

  • Perform the project initial assessment and estimate the work effort
  • Secure the project funding and identify the right resource to assign the projects and track them
  • Raise application dependencies and risk on time and escalate to management and migrating the risk.
  • Defining and executing test automation strategies by partnering with business and development teams supporting in sprint test automation.
  • Create, execute and maintain new automated test scenarios and data sets.
  • Work as part of an agile product team, to deliver quality automation aligned with each sprint to support DevOps
  • Provide project technical knowledge to the team.
  • Collaborate: Work with technical and non-technical team members to ensure clear, concise communication is being maintained between development, production, and operations teams.
  • Design and build: write comprehensive test suites and test cases for both automated and manual tests to support confident, rapid deployments and scheduled releases.
  • Performed System Integration testing and recorded issues along with product enhancements. Worked with Engineers to troubleshoot problems and inconsistencies.
  • Formulate methods to perform Positive and Negative testing against requirements. Conducted Unit, System testing.
  • Implementing Selenium testing platform and using test scripts with Eclipse IDE, writing Selenium Web driver scripts, using JUnit and Selenium, Cucumber for automated testing.
  • Use of XPath in the context of Selenium RC in order to pick out page elements in a robust manner by avoiding index based expressions. These XPath were then abstracted behind Page Object classes to provide a central point of change of any UI changes made in the application.
  • Performed Verification, Validation, and Transformations on the Input data (Text files, XML files) before loading into target database.
  • Performed cross browser testing for compatibility checks on IE, Firefox and Chrome
  • Performed Data Driven testing with multiple test data inputs with Selenium Webdriver and MS-Excel.
  • Optimized Selenium scripts for Regression testing of the application with various data
  • Assessing the Scrum Maturity of the team and organization and coaching the team to higher levels of maturity, Confidential a pace that is sustainable and comfortable for the team and organization
  • Building a trusting and safe environment where problems can be raised without fear of blame, retribution, or being judged, with an emphasis of healing and problem solving
  • Assisting with internal and external communication, improving transparency, and radiating information
  • Supporting and educating the Product Owner, especially with respect to grooming and maintaining the product backlog
  • Providing all support to the team using a servant leadership style whenever possible, and leading

Confidential, St Louis, MO 

QA Automation Lead

Responsibilities:

  • Involved in analyzing the business requirements, functional requirements and technical requirements documents.
  • Involved in writing Test plan, Test strategy and test scenarios to test business requirements using word, Excel.
  • Created Test Cases for regression, GUI testing and functional testing, Back-end and compatibility testing based on the system requirements.
  • Involved in system Testing, Integration Testing, Functionality Testing, Regression, End-End Testing and User acceptance Testing.
  • Automate Test Cases and create Test Suites locally within Eclipse for Functional, Integration, Regression, and Browser Compatibility, using Selenium WebDriver, Testing.
  • Experience testing with Internet Explorer, Firefox and Chrome browser
  • Designed and developed automation framework using Key Word Driver and Data Driven methods
  • Involved in testing compatibility of application for dynamic and static content under various cross browser using HTML IDs and Xpath in selenium.
  • Handle the tasks of identifying defects and perform root cause analysis by analyzing data quality issues
  • Maintained the Selenium and Java automation code and resources in source control like CVS,SVN over the time for improvements and new features
  • Maintain automation builds on Continuous Integration (CI) tool Jenkins.
  • Used Maven as Build Integration Tool.

Confidential 

QA Automation Lead

Responsibilities:

  • Developed Automation Script using Selenium WebDriver, Eclipse, Testing and Java
  • Tested compatibility of application for dynamic and static content under various cross browser using HTML IDs and Xpath in selenium.
  • Involved in performing Smoke, Functional, System and Regression and backend Testing
  • Developed Hybrid framework with Selenium
  • Used Selenium GRID to execute test cases in parallel on different target machines
  • Communicated with QA Lead and QA Team members to resolve issues
  • Reported software problems using ALM bug trucking system and verified bugs fixed in new releases
  • Identified and documented defects using ALM to ensure application functionality
  • Worked with QA team and developers to improve processes. Performed quality reviews to improve test maturity
  • Executed SQL queries to verify proper insertion, deletion, and updates to the Database
  • Prepared user documentation with screenshots for UAT (User Acceptance testing)
  • Utilized Confluence for reporting weekly status on area of ownership. Attended meetings to influence building quality into the product cycle

Confidential

Test Lead

Responsibilities:

  • Understand the requirement and analysis the requirement
  • Preparing the High-Level Scenario and Review with Client
  • Prepare the Test plan and involve into Test internal & external review.
  • Preparing details level test cases and conducting the Internal and external review.
  • Performing in Integration and End-to-End Testing, Regression and UAT Testing
  • Identifies the defect and report defect in ALM-QC
  • Closely working with application teams and co-coordinating with them to get resolve the issues and retest the defect on time.
  • Involving in Service Assurance and trouble ticket creation
  • Performing Telecom various Bill verification and report to customer
  • Preparing the Daily status and providing to the Client on the daily End of the day meeting with all stakeholders

Confidential

Test Lead (Selenium Automation)

Responsibilities:

  • Interacted with the clients to gather & analyze business requirements of the various modules of the project.
  • Extensively involved in the design, coding, deployment, and maintenance of the project.
  • Implementation of View and Controller components with Struts Framework, Model components with EJBs.
  • Written ant build.xml files for ear and war files generation.
  • Written the JMeter scripts to test the performance (stress) of the application by increasing the concurrent users.
  • Worked on threads, to submit the messages to smp server.
  • Worked onsite Confidential the client place involved in the UAT Build, Configuration, Deployment, and Integration.

We'd love your feedback!